Output f3141512f57af91789431d6f703fd62372cbca7be0251b8ba5cfd08d0d69216e:8

value
26552061
script pubkey
OP_0 OP_PUSHBYTES_20 14bdc15d5833fe2e3221116a6bcdc8bde8f6e9e8
address
ltc1qzj7uzh2cx0lzuv3pz94xhnwghh50d60g7kka4a
transaction
f3141512f57af91789431d6f703fd62372cbca7be0251b8ba5cfd08d0d69216e
spent
true